ubuntu-10.10 problem...hdd crash

Asked by sanyprashant

Hi all,

i installed ubuntu 10.10 in my hp-laptop having samsung hard disk of 250gb.
installation got finished without any error......after installation it becomes very slow
i did restart but it is not shuting down....so i did hard boot 4-5 times...
and after boot i did fsck also to repair bad sector....but after this during next boot i got
SMART status failure id=1...

plz help

1.Boot your computer from LiveCD, and run application (CTRL+F2):
palimpsest

2. Choose your disk from list, click "SMART Data", please upload screenshot with opened SMART attributes (example window:
http://tinyurl.com/28dcvkn ). Please maximise that window, so we can see more information.

3. After that click "Run self-test", and choose extended test. It can take 2 hours.
